About This Role

Assist in delivering individualized occupational therapy to residents in a Long-Term Care setting. Monitor and document patient progress, collaborating with interdisciplinary teams to provide holistic care and impact residents' independence and quality of life.

Responsibilities

  • Assist in delivering individualized therapy based on treatment plans developed by the Occupational Therapist
  • Implement activities to improve daily living skills (e.g., dressing, eating, mobility)
  • Track and document patient progress, adhering to facility policies
  • Report changes or concerns to the Occupational Therapist
  • Work with interdisciplinary teams (e.g., PT, OT, nursing) to provide holistic care
  • Educate patients and families on therapeutic exercises, adaptive equipment, and strategies for independence
  • Lead or assist patients with exercises, activities of daily living, and other therapeutic tasks
  • Create a positive and supportive environment to encourage patient engagement

Requirements

  • Associate’s degree in Occupational Therapy Assistant program from an accredited school
  • Certification as an Occupational Therapy Assistant (COTA) through the National Board for Certification in Occupational Therapy (NBCOT)
  • Current state licensure (or eligibility) to practice as a Certified Occupational Therapy Assistant
